How to Raise Funds for Your Startup?
Explore the best funding options to fuel your startup’s growth.
Securing funding is one of the biggest challenges for startups, but the right strategy can make all the difference.

Crowdfunding
Leverage the Power of Community
Crowdfunding platforms and social media allow you to connect with a broad network of investors who share your vision. Build a compelling campaign, tell your story authentically, and offer rewards to supporters.
Crowdfunding is not just about raising funds—it’s also a great way to build a loyal community around your idea.

Friends and Family
Start Close to Home
Approaching friends and family for funding is often one of the first steps for startups. These supporters are likely to trust you and your vision, offering funding with fewer conditions.
Be sure to treat these investments professionally, setting clear terms and expectations to maintain relationships.

Angel Investors
Angel investors are individuals who provide significant financial support to startups, typically in exchange for equity. These investors are often willing to take risks on innovative ideas.
To attract angel investors, showcase your startup’s potential for high growth and your personal passion for success.

Private Investors
Flexible Funding, Tailored to Your Needs
Private investors look for promising startups to fund, offering flexible terms and personalized agreements.
This can be a valuable resource for startups in need of capital without the strict requirements of traditional financing. Make sure to identify investors aligned with your industry and vision.

Venture Capitalists (VCs)
Secure Major Funding for High-Growth Startups
VCs are firms that invest in startups with strong scalability potential in exchange for equity.
If your business demonstrates innovation and the ability to disrupt markets, venture capital funding can propel you toward significant milestones. Be prepared with a polished pitch and detailed financial projections to make a strong case.

Microloans
Small Loans, Big Opportunities
Microloans are ideal for startups that need smaller amounts of capital. These loans often come with flexible terms, making them accessible to early-stage businesses.
Research programs or organizations that offer microloans tailored to your industry for the best results.
